Carmen Tartera has authored 23 papers that have received a total of 789 indexed citations.
This includes 10 papers in Ecology, 9 papers in Food Science and 7 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(10 papers),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(6 papers) and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(5 papers). Carmen Tartera is often cited by papers focused on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(10 papers),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(6 papers) and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States and Spain. Carmen Tartera's co-authors include Jayanthi Gangiredla, Mark K. Mammel, J. Jofre, Juan Jofre and David W. Lacher and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Journal of Bacteriology and Infection and Immunity
